Do the other planets have atmospheres and are they different to Earth's?

The atmospheres of planets in the solar system have differences compared to what exists on Earth. Each planet has its own unique atmospheric composition and pressure. All the planets in the solar system, including Earth, have atmospheres. Mercury's atmosphere is very thin and mostly made up of particles from the sun and surface decay. Venus has a hot, dense atmosphere, mainly composed of carbon dioxide. Earth's atmosphere has nitrogen, oxygen, and other gases and is composed of 78% nitrogen, 21% oxygen with some neon, carbon dioxide, and other gasses. Mars' atmosphere is mainly composed of carbon dioxide. Jupiter is a gas giant, with an atmosphere that is about 90% hydrogen and 10% helium. Saturn is another gas giant with an atmosphere that contains hydrogen and helium, with sulfur that makes it yellowish. Uranus has an atmosphere of hydrogen and helium with ices such as ammonia, water, and methane. Finally, Neptune has an atmosphere containing hydrogen and helium with ices such as methane.
